[[:encoded, "Practicing yoga and mindfulness has many health benefits. Yoga is a low-impact form of exercise that can lead to better heart health and help with back pain relief that many entrepreneurs can use. Mindfulness and meditation can lead to better cognitive health and improved moods. In addition to the health benefits that mindfulness and exercise bring, they can contribute positively to our business success as well.\n\nIn a fast-paced business world, learning how to slow down is immensely important, and can give you an edge over your competitors. Not only that, but calming our minds and being able to craft a clear vision and leave room for inspired thoughts is a practice that we can refine and utilize to push our business forward.\n\nLet’s now explore the six ways that mindfulness and exercise can impact your business success. \n\n1. Mindfulness gives us clarity over our business vision\nMindfulness is being aware of your thoughts, your feelings, and your environment. It’s the act of removing ourselves from the hustle and bustle of our current state, and creating space for our mind to wander and to reconnect with ourselves. By practicing mindfulness, we can gain important insights into our vision for our business.\n\nYou can practice mindfulness with just a few simple steps:\n\nFocus on Your Breathing\nStart a steady pattern of breathing in, holding it for a few seconds, and then exhaling out. Feel the sensation of your breath as it comes in through your nose and out through your mouth.\n\nBe Aware of Your Body\nAs you breathe, start to be more aware of your body. Pay attention to how you’re feeling and the places where you are holding tension, and breathe through it to release the tension.\n\nLet Your Mind Wander\nGive your mind the freedom to wander. You may be surprised where it takes you when you’re not hyper-focused on your to-do list (or Prioritized Action List (PAL) as I like to call it).\n\nAllowing ourselves the space to be present in the moment helps strip away things that may seem more pressing. You may be stressing about how to move your business forward and practicing mindfulness could bring you back to a place of remembering your “why” and what you’re truly passionate about, which could provide clarity into a longer-term vision.\n\n2.
